跳到主要内容

MySQL 数据库兼容性

保持软件版本的最新状态对于确保兼容性和最大化效率至关重要。MySQL 作为一个强大的开源数据库管理系统,被全球数百万用户用于数据管理。然而,随着 MySQL 的不断发展,数据库也需要与最新版本保持兼容。在本指南中,我们将探讨更新 MySQL 数据库的实用步骤和注意事项,以确保与所提供版本的无缝兼容,提升您的数据管理能力,并确保系统保持强大和可靠。

MySQL 数据库兼容性

为了确保在使用较旧版本的 MySQL 导出数据库时的兼容性,您可以使用带有特定选项的 mysqldump 命令。您可以在服务器的命令行中运行以下命令:

mysqldump --compatible=mysql40 -udb_USERNAME -pdb_PASSWORD db_name > FILENAME

以下是该命令的详细说明:

mysqldump

这是 MySQL 提供的命令行工具,用于生成逻辑数据库备份。它创建一组 SQL 语句,可以执行这些语句来重现原始数据库的结构和数据。

--compatible=mysql40

此选项调整输出格式,使其与特定版本的 MySQL 兼容,此处为 MySQL 4.0。如果您尝试将数据库导入不支持某些新版本特性或语法的旧版本 MySQL,这个选项非常有用。

-u db_USERNAME

-u 选项指定连接 MySQL 服务器时使用的用户名。请将 db_USERNAME 替换为实际的用户名。注意,-u 与用户名之间不能有空格。

-pdb_PASSWORD

此选项指定连接 MySQL 服务器时使用的密码。注意 -p 与密码 db_PASSWORD 之间无空格。请将 db_PASSWORD 替换为实际的数据库密码。

db_name

这是您想要导出的数据库名称。请将 db_name 替换为实际的数据库名称。

FILENAME

该部分将 mysqldump 命令的输出重定向到文件。请将 FILENAME 替换为您希望备份保存的文件名,如果需要保存到特定位置,请包含路径。

总结

保持 MySQL 数据库的最新状态对于确保其与最新版本兼容至关重要,这有助于提升数据管理能力并维护系统的可靠性。本指南通过使用带有特定兼容性选项的 mysqldump 命令,提供了一个实用示例,帮助您在从旧版本导出数据库时实现 MySQL 数据库的兼容性。

通过保持 MySQL 数据库与最新版本同步,您可以充分发挥数据管理系统的潜力。为确保数据库导出与旧版本 MySQL 兼容,请使用带有适当兼容性选项的 mysqldump 命令。这一做法不仅有助于应对软件版本兼容性的挑战,还在优化您的技术基础设施以实现最佳性能和可靠性方面发挥着重要作用。